**Responsibilities and Accountabilities**:
Responsible for the strategic progression of the Commercial Insights SharePoint Ecosystem in alignment with IS/DX organization’s technology roadmap.
Accountable for managing a team of technical SharePoint resources (e.g. developers, testers, designer, architect, project manager, business analyst). This technical team is responsible for the operational upkeep (“keeping the lights on” or BAU = business as usual) of the Commercial SharePoint Ecosystem.
Engage with other Commercial (e.g. CCO Office, OmniChannel Strategy and Operations, etc.) and non-Commercial stakeholders (e.g. Medical Affairs, Finance, Procurement, Corporate Communications, etc.) in various business strategic programs and in support coordination of business change management.
Effectively support the triage, coordination, and prioritization of new demands/requirements/change requests and project initiatives involving and/or dependent on the Ecosystem.
Champion the adoption of Agile methodology in both project delivery and continuous integrations and continuous delivery (CI/CD) of efficient and scalable data management and integrations, reporting, and analytics solutions.
**Required Qualifications**:
Bachelor’s degree in Computer or Information/Data Science, Information Systems, or STEM field.
Knowledge and experience with Microsoft SharePoint (preferably Online/365) and other Microsoft products.
Familiarity with Data Warehousing concepts such as data transformations and integrations, data quality and integrity standards, etc.
Familiarity with some of the following enterprise solutions and Business Intelligence tools: SAP, Qlik, Tableau, or equivalent.
Excellent organizational, project planning, and business change management skills with strong attention to detail. Ability to effectively manage cross-functional projects utilizing project/program management tools such as (but not limited to): MS Azure DevOps, JIRA, MS Project, or equivalent.
Adept in System Development Life Cycle (SDLC) and Agile project management methodologies.
Demonstrated ability to understand business requirements/scope and translating them into functional/technical specifications.
Strong communication, facilitation, presentation, and influencing skills to effectively interact with a diverse audience and gain impact with senior-level decision makers.
Proven experience in stakeholder management, vendor management, and team building.
Ability to work effectively in a team environment (cross-functional), collaborating with diverse groups of stakeholders, including business and technical colleagues from various areas and in various roles within the company, across multiple cultures and regions, facilitating effective collaboration in diverse environments.
Self-directed with strong attention to detail and must be able to multi-task in a fast-paced environment with flexibility to adapt to changing requirements, technologies, and shifting priorities.
**Qualifications Preferred**:
Master’s Degree in Computer or Information/Data Science, Information Systems, or STEM field
Certifications in appropriate area(s) such as PMP, MS SharePoint, etc.
Strong knowledge of Agile methodologies and frameworks such as Scrum, Kanban, etc. Adept in project management delivery tools such as: MS Azure DevOps, MS Project, or equivalent.
Pharmaceutical or BioPharma experience with good understanding of enterprise and secondary/external Commercial data sources commonly used (e.g., script level, patient longitudinal, promotional, omnichannel data, etc.)
